RFCS Steel Big Tickets — Steel and Metals Action Plan
Funded large-scale pilot and demonstration projects for new low-carbon steelmaking processes and advanced steel grades, reaching TRL 7-8.
Projects are expected to achieve TRL 7-8 by completion, include an exploitation strategy for industrial integration, and quantify targeted improvements against existing installations or the relevant Emissions Trading Scheme benchmark. This topic carried its own EUR 25 million 2026 budget, separate from the sibling recycling-focused topic (EUR 50 million) in the same call document.
This 'Big Ticket' topic funds pilot or demonstration projects addressing new, sustainable and low-carbon steelmaking and finishing processes (Article 8 of Council Decision 2008/376/EC), or advanced steel grades and applications (Article 9). Proposals focused on recycling technologies instead belong under the sibling RFCS-2026-BT-Steel-CID topic in the same call.
